Kohli Reaches To Another Milestone

India's captain Virat Kohli was in full flow on the second day of the first Test at Edgbaston, Birmingham on August 2. He played a masterful innings of 149 on a pitch where the ball was swinging all the day.

It was Kohli's 1st Test ton in England and 22nd of his Test career. During his masterful innings, Kohli became the quickest to reach 7000 runs as captain in international cricket.

He surpassed the great Brian Lara to reach this milestone. He took just 124 innings, 40 fewer to Lara to get those runs.

Kohli is also the fastest to 4000, 5000, and 6000 runs in international cricket as captain having taken only 73, 93, and 106 innings respectively.

CAPTAINS FASTEST TO 7000 RUNS IN INTERNATIONAL CRICKET:

1. V KOHLI (IND) - 124 innings (105 Matches)
2. B LARA (WI) - 164 innings (136 Matches)
3. R PONTING (AUS) - 165 innings (149 Matches)
4. M CLARKE (AUS) - 166 innings (136 Matches)
5. A COOK (ENG) - 171 innings (124 Matches)
